The leader of Bulgarian party GERB stated that neither Delyan Peevski will take over the Neftochim refinery, nor will Kiril Petkov and Asen Vasilev take it over.
We are waiting for President Radev to make a decision - to veto or to pass the law. We have a name for a special manager at Lukoil, which has been agreed with our partners.
This was stated by GERB leader Boyko Borissov to journalists in parliament after the president said that a special commercial manager (OTU) should have been appointed at the Burgas refinery on October 23, BGNES reports.
His only role is to either veto or approve it, not to give us advice. I know why he did it, he was annoyed by a letter I sent him confidentially, Borissov added without giving details.
I can assure President Radev that all our actions are coordinated with the European Commission, OPAC, and the US Department of Energy. So the only thing I ask is for him to make a decision, Borissov added.
According to him, if Radev does not impose a veto, a special administrator will be appointed immediately.
Everything is calm -- we have gasoline for six months, diesel for four, and kerosene for two months, explained the leader of GERB.
Borissov was adamant that Peevski would not take over the refinery, nor would Kiril Petkov and Asen Vasilev. Everything will be agreed with our partners - both in Europe and America, Boiko Borissov assured. | BGNES
